The Panasonic SDR-H21GC is a camcorder that stands out for its exceptional image quality in good lighting, thanks to the brand's advanced technology. Its ergonomic design makes it easy to handle, making its use enjoyable even during extended sessions. With generous storage capacity, it allows for recording numerous events without having to change media, making it a practical choice for users of all levels. However, this model has some drawbacks. The image quality in low light is inferior to that of other newer camcorders, which may limit its effectiveness in difficult lighting conditions. Additionally, the battery life may not be sufficient for extended recordings, requiring frequent recharges. The lack of advanced features such as Wi-Fi or Bluetooth may also restrict connectivity and video sharing. Finally, while the modern design is appreciated, some users may find it bulky compared to more compact models. Overall, the Panasonic SDR-H21GC offers good value for money, combining performance and reliability, despite some limitations on certain features.Score details
